About 1-[2-(cyclopentanecarbonyl)-4-fluorophenyl]-3-[4-(methanesulfonamidomethyl)-5-pyridin-2-ylsulfanyl-1,3-thiazol-2-yl]urea

1-[2-(cyclopentanecarbonyl)-4-fluorophenyl]-3-[4-(methanesulfonamidomethyl)-5-pyridin-2-ylsulfanyl-1,3-thiazol-2-yl]urea (PubChem CID 87229975) has the molecular formula C23H24FN5O4S3 and a molecular weight of 549.68 g/mol. Its IUPAC name is 1-[2-(cyclopentanecarbonyl)-4-fluorophenyl]-3-[4-(methanesulfonamidomethyl)-5-pyridin-2-ylsulfanyl-1,3-thiazol-2-yl]urea.
